I have a rear bath 1972 sovereign and would like to replace the mirror over the sink and the lenses on the make up lights due to yellowing. I have found new lens/covers for my ceiling fixtures and galley/bedroom lights but have been striking out on anything for the bathroom. Any suggestions?

Unless you want to keep a museum restoration, it might be easier to replace the lights entirely with some newer LED ones. That way you get new lenses, new electrics, and much lower power use. I don't remember how the bath lights in the '72's looked, but unless they are some Airstream built exclusive, you can probably just replace them with a fixture built today.
